document.write( "Question 1136847: I am trying to figure out how the area of a right trapezoid and the shorter base was calculated. From a diagram, the longer base is 8cm. The shorter base is unknown. The height is 3 cm. The slant height is 5 cm. I do not know how the total area was calculated at 18cm (squared) and the shorter base was calculated at 4 cm. \n" ); document.write( "

the longer base is equal to 8 cm.
\n" ); document.write( "the height is equal to 3 cm.
\n" ); document.write( "the slant height is equal to 5 cm.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"if it is a right trapezoid, then two of the angles have to be right angles.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"label your trapezoid ABCDE clockwise from top left.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"angle A and angle E are right angles.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"the slant height is side BC = 5.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"the height is BD = 3 and AE = 3.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"the triangle on the right is right triangle BCD where the 90 degree angle is BDC.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"angles BDE and ABD are also right angles.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"use pythagorus to find the length of DC, which is 4.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"pythagorus says 3^2 + x^2 = 5^2\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"solve for x to get x = sqrt(5^2 - 3^2) = sqrt(16) = 4.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"that makes ED = 4 and, consequently AB = 4 because ABDE forms a rectangle.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"the area of the trapezoid is equal to the area of the rectangle plus the area of the triangle.\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"this becomes 4 * 3 + 1/2 * 3 * 4 which becomes 12 + 6 = 18.\r
